'Happy Feet' reigns at US Box Office
Published Monday, Nov 27 2006, 22:54 GMT | By David Cribb
Happy Feet maintained its position at the top of the US Box Office this weekend, seeing off Casino Royale for the second week running.
The animated film took $37.9 million, taking its gross up over $100 million.
Deja Vu and Deck The Halls went straight in at number tree and four respectively, with Borat dropping two places to fifth.
The top ten in full:
1. Happy Feet - $37.9m
2. Casino Royale - $31m
3. Deja Vu - $20.8m
4. Deck the Halls - $12m
5. Borat: Cultural Learnings of America for Make Benefit Glorious Nation of Kazakhstan - $10.4m
6. The Santa Clause 3: The Escape Clause - $10m
7. Stranger Than Fiction - $6m
8. Flushed Away - $5.84m
9. Bobby - $4.91m
10. The Fountain - $3.73m
